Misted Up Glazing Repair
A stained window is an indication that the seals on your windows have failed. This lets moisture get into the glass and cause it to condense. It is important to act immediately to restore the aesthetics of your windows and protect your home from water damage.
Double-glazed windows are formed from two glass panes that are sealed with a gap thermally efficient spacer bars. The result is an insulating barrier that is filled with gas or air, which keeps the warm air in and cold out.

A damaged seal or desiccant can lead to misty windows. Both of these issues are fixable. A window restoration company can fix the damaged seal and replace the desiccant to stop fogging and condensation. This is a cost-effective solution that could require major repairs to your frame and may not be covered by a warranty.
Another method to repair the glass that has become smudgey is to make a small hole in the glass unit and then pump a specific drying agent into. While this method works however it is not advised by FENSA-regulated firms because the holes could weaken the unit in the future and cause leakage or damage.
There are a myriad of methods to repair a window that has been misted. But the best option is to contact an approved installer from FENSA who will inspect your home and make recommendations. The structure of double-glazed windows is what makes them so effective The two glass panes are separated by a spacer that is filled with trapped gas or air. This creates an insulating barrier which helps to retain heat and block cold air, however the seal may become damaged as time passes. When this happens, moisture can seep in and condense on the spacer bar, causing it to look misty.
